About Sycamore House
Sycamore House is an end-of-terrace house in Ambleside (LA22 0BX).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 931 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2010) shows an F (score 30),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would push it to E (score 41). The latest certificate is from October 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include new windows,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 83% of similar EPCs). Last sold in April 2013, so it's been off the market for around 13 years. Across 2011–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 14.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£464,000 is 38.7% above the 2013 sale price.
